Adding a Storage Mirroring server to be monitored

After you have installed Storage Mirroring Reporting Center, you must configure it to monitor your

Storage Mirroring servers.
In order to monitor a Storage Mirroring server, you must define it in the navigation tree as a “Node”

in the user interface. To set up a Storage Mirroring server:

1.

In the navigation tree, select the Storage Mirroring Servers node.

2.

Right-click the node and select

Configuration, New, New Node. The Server Properties dialog

box appears.

3.

In the Server Properties dialog box, enter the hostname of the server you wish to monitor in the

Name field. Optionally, add a description for the host in the Description field.

4.

Specify a

Username and Password of an administrator on the host you will be monitoring. This

is used to connect to the server to gather data.

5.

Create aliases for any alternative names for the host. Click

Add to create an alias. Alias creation

is recommended in certain situations in which there are problems with name resolution.

6.

Click

OK.

You may configure Group Nodes in the same manner and place or create your Storage Mirroring

servers within various groups. For more information, see

Creating a group

on page 4-4.

Importing Storage Mirroring servers to be

monitored

You can import a list of servers and groups that has been exported as an .xml file from the Storage

Mirroring Management Console.

1.

Select

File, Import.

2.

Browse to the .xml file that contains your server information, then click

Open.

3.

After the import is complete, select the imported servers in the navigation tree.

4.

Right-click, then select

Configuration, Assign Credentials.

5.

In the

Server username field, enter the name of an administrator who has access to the

Storage Mirroring server. For more information about permissions that need to be assigned to

the username, see

Adding a Storage Mirroring server to be monitored

on page 4-1.

6.

In the

Server password field, enter the password for the administrator.

7.

When you are finished, click

OK.
